Leaders Identify Atrophy
What is atrophy? It is anything that is wasting away.
Because of the fall of man and the entrance of sin into the world, atrophy happens all the time.
Let me give you some examples.
If a farmer doesn't tend to his field, it will grow weeds.
If an athlete doesn't workout, he will grow weaker.
If a husband doesn't spent time with his wife, they will grow apart.
If a business owner doesn't work his business, it will fail.
If a Christian doesn't exercise himself to godliness, he will grow carnal.
The world is not winding up; it is winding down.
Leaders identify atrophy. What does that mean?
You need to identify what is wasting away. What is growing weak? What is losing momentum?
How do you recover from atrophy?
You need to put your hand to it. You need to pray over it. You need to cast vision for it. You need to work it. You need to strengthen it. You need to budget it. You need to spend time with it.
